Transaction 690f5a6c0778417daa02f681e61ff16635e8fb329e26822032d24e4b677711e3
1 Input
1 Output
-
690f5a6c0778417daa02f681e61ff16635e8fb329e26822032d24e4b677711e3:0
- value
- 324887
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 03d1bdf5b864a943aa25196a5ac8636141bf2352 OP_EQUAL
- address
- 323DDFWgMYSGbNEHU4Ht29yQUHBMu42XCq